The inside rear wall of my 170 center console is less than a 1/4 inch thick therefore I am unable to attatch anything to it without through drilling which I don't want to do.

I was wondering if anyone has tried to glue a piece of taco board, ect. to the vertical area to facilitate connection of electronics. I have filled up the area running along the bottom of the wall and would like to attatch an on board charger to the verticle area above.
